Specific technical specifications and data profiles for the bullet train Unicode Consortium representation:
| Unicode Name | bullet train |
|---|---|
| Group Category | Travel & Places |
| Sub-group category | transport-ground |
| Hex Codepoint | 1F685 |
| Shortcode notation | :bullet_train: (Slack / Discord) |
| UTF-8 Hex Bytes | F0 9F 9A 85 |
| UTF-16 Hex Surrogate | D83D DE85 |

What is the Unicode code point for the bullet train emoji?
The official Unicode Consortium hexadecimal code point for bullet train is 1F685. It is cataloged under the Travel & Places group and the transport-ground subgroup.
